Ph0wn 2023 - Light weight but heavy duty
This is the solution of the challenge “Light weight but heavy duty” from Ph0wn 2023 CTF we solved together with @FdLSifu. It was a ARM reverse engineering of the block cipher PRESENT.
This is the solution of the challenge “Light weight but heavy duty” from Ph0wn 2023 CTF we solved together with @FdLSifu. It was a ARM reverse engineering of the block cipher PRESENT.
This is the solution of the challenge “ChatWithPico” from Ph0wn 2023 CTF we solved together with @FdLSifu. It was an interaction with a chatGPT prompt well protected to avoid secret leakage and including a small reverse engineering task.
A recent feature of Jadx allows to easily hook functions in Frida.
This is the solution of the challenge “Schnorr Signatures” from Black Alps 2023 CTF. It was Schnorr signatures with a known prefix of 128 bits set to zero.
This is the solution of the challenge “Spooky Safebox” from Hack.lu 2023 CTF. It was a ECDSA signature with a known prefix but with a limited number of signatures. Applying the Bounded Distance Decoding with Predicate algorithm allows to recover the private key.
This is the solution of the challenge “Baby RSA” from CCCamp 2023. It was a RSA whitebox implementation in Python with a left to right windowed exponentiation.